We'll be back for the race on Sunday... make sure you join us again then.

- 

Spies will start seventh, ahead of Pedrosa, Edwarrds and Capirossi.

- 

Lorenzo and Simoncelli join Stoner on the front row while Bautista, Dovizioso and Hayden make up the second row.

There's the flag and Casey Stoner wins his fourth successive Phillip Island pole!

1' 

That's it for Pedrosa - and he'll start on the third row at best.

2' 

Pedrosa's down in eighth at the moment... he needs something big at the death if he's to improve.

3' 

Bautista doesn't last long there though as Simoncelli shunts him back to the second row.

4' 

Stoner improves again - 1:29.975 is the time to beat now - as Bautista moves up onto the front row!

6' 

Stoner improves his best time to 1:29.981 and another pole position for the Aussie looks odds on now!

8' 

Lorenzo and Hayden romp onto the front row, leaving Simoncelli, Pedrosa and Dovizioso on the second row.

11' 

So, with just over 10 minutes left, Stoner is in pole position, followed by Simoncelli, Pedrosa, Lorenzo, Dovizioso and Spies.

13' 

Lorenzo was unhappy with Bautista... he's still fuming as he waits to get back out on track.

15' 

Rossi is down in 15th place at the moment. This has been a weekend to forget for the Doctor.

16' 

Not for long! Stoner delivers with just over a quarter of an hour remaining as he sets the benchmark of 1:30.042 - and claims provisional pole!

17' 

Dovizioso storms round to move third, pushing Stoner back into fourth!

18' 

Stoner leaves the pits and surely we can expect more from him now.

19' 

Simoncelli is currently in fifth, ahead of Dovizioso, Capirossi, De Puniet, Bautista and Edwards.

20' 

The day's other big faller, Ben Spies, puts in a storming lap to go fourth - great determination from the American.

21' 

Aoyama is off his bike... he's hobbling gingerly but it looks like he'll be ok.

22' 

Lorenzo is back in the garage and he doesn't look happy about something.

26' 

Lorenzo is looking good but lose about half a second in the final split and as long as he does that he's not going to knock Pedrosa off his perch.

28' 

Pedrosa blitzes through to set the fastest time of the session - a 1:30.871.

28' 

Pedrosa jumps up into fourth place with a lap of 1:31.372.

29' 

Spies is back in the Yamaha Factory Racing garage and he's stretching off. Surely he's in some pain, but he looks like he's going to try to ignore it.

30' 

Half way through the qualification session as Capirossi wobbles a little on his way through.

33' 

Bautista edges Edwards out of sixth as news reaches us that Spies will be back on track before too long.

36' 

There's a bit of a lull at the moment in this qualification session. Nearly half way through.

38' 

Spies is at the medical centre... he was holding his ribs as he entered.

40' 

Hayden continues to improve, creeping up to sixth now.

41' 

Stoner's off his bike, but it doesn't look like he's dropped it.

42' 

Rossi, who's endured a tough weekend so far, is down in 11th at the moment.

43' 

Hayden moves up to seventh, behind Ayoama, De Puniet, Dovizioso, Simoncelli, Stoner and leader Lorenzo.

46' 

Lorenzo improves to a 1:30.991 and Stoner is still looking to topple the Yamaha Factory Racing man.

48' 

Aoyama moves up to fourth as the local fans watch on, wondering when Stoner is going to hit the top of the timesheets.

50' 

So, Lorenzo leads from Stoner, De Puniet and Pedrosa.

52'

There's someone off at Turn 3... it's Ben Spies! He's having to be helped away by stewards in pink jackets... that doesn't look good at all.

54' 

De Puniet follows suit to move into provisional second as the sun actually peeps out from behind the clouds.

55' 

Lorenzo sets down an early marker with a 1:31.488.

57' 

Here's hot favourite Stoner now, looking good as he blazes round on his Honda.

58' 

Of course, Casey Stoner has been the form man so far this weekend at his home GP and the Aussie is definitely the rider to beat.

59' 

Today's temperature is 17 degrees...

60' 

We we go then... an hour of qualifying for the Aussie GP at a typically blustery Phillip Island circuit!
